What Deportation Means and Why It Happens
Deportation, formally known as removal, represents the legal procedure whereby the United States federal government directs a non-citizen to exit the country. There are multiple factors why removal proceedings may be commenced. Common causes encompass visa overstays, felony convictions, illegal crossing into the United States, fraud or misrepresentation on immigration-related documentation, and violations of the requirements of a visa or green card. In Huber Heights, similar to the rest of South Carolina, immigration enforcement is performed by national bodies, chiefly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E). Once ICE determines an person as possibly removable, the process is set in motion with the serving of a Notice to Appear (NTA), which is the official charging document that starts proceedings in immigration court.

Key Steps in the Deportation Defense Process
The deportation defense process usually follows a succession of systematic steps. First, the person is issued a Notice to Appear, which sets forth the government’s charges and the statutory justification for requesting deportation. After the NTA is submitted with the immigration tribunal, a master calendar hearing is scheduled. This initial hearing is much like an arraignment in criminal court, where the respondent responds to the allegations, and the judge establishes upcoming hearing dates. During this hearing, the respondent can specify whether they will be seeking any type of reprieve from removal.
Following the master calendar hearing, the procedure typically advances to an individual merits hearing. This is the step where the respondent presents supporting documentation, summons witnesses, and makes juridical contentions in favor of their case. The government, represented by an ICE trial attorney, also presents its position for removal. The immigration judge then evaluates the evidence and juridical arguments before issuing a judgment. If the judge directs removal, the respondent retains the entitlement to appeal the determination to the Board of Immigration Appeals (BIA), and in some circumstances, to federal circuit courts.
Common Forms of Relief from Deportation
One of the most vital components of a deportation defense strategy is identifying the right kind of protection. A number of legal avenues could be available based on the individual’s specific conditions. Cancellation of removal is one such pathway, available to equally legal long-term holders of residency and particular non-permanent category of residents who satisfy precise qualifying criteria, such as uninterrupted physical presence in the United States and demonstration of exceptional and extraordinarily unusual suffering to qualifying family relatives.
Asylum is an additional form of legal protection available to people who have undergone persecution or have a justified fear of oppression in their native country on the basis of race, faith, nationality, political stance, or belonging to a distinct social category. Withholding of deportation and safeguarding under the Convention Against Torture are similar categories of relief with stricter burden of proof benchmarks but offer protection from deportation to a specific country.
Adjustment of status, voluntary departure, and prosecutorial discretion are other options that may be applicable in specific situations. Each kind of remedy has its unique collection of requirements, and evaluating suitability demands a detailed evaluation of the applicant’s immigration history, criminal-related history, familial relationships, and additional pertinent elements.
